F.C. High’s Kheirich Gets $10k Scholarship from Greenspring

Razan Kheirich of Falls Church High School was selected to receive a $10,000 scholarship from Greenspring, an independent living apartment community in Springfield. Scholarships awarded by Greenspring come from Greenspring’s Scholars Fund; residents, resident clubs, and staff members at Greenspring donate money to the Scholars Fund.

Scholarships go to high school students who have worked in dining services at the retirement community to fund the students’ education at the college or professional school of their choice. Students must have worked at least 1,000 hours at the community during their junior and senior years of high school, received satisfactory grades, and maintained a disciplinary record free of adverse actions at their high school.
